People, People Who Need People This year a new idea was introduced to Reicher by Sister Fran Maher, Father Mike Mulvey, and Sister Lillian Newbore. The idea was for Senior students, when unstructured for three mods, to go to a place in the com- munity where help was needed. According to the results of numerous evaluation sheets, the success was outstanding. The concept of ser- vice as stated by Sister Fran was for students to become more aware of the outside world by working with various types of people. It is evident that we have a service program where students reach out to other people, and that is what we as Christian people are called to do .
